BALE


Meaning of BALE in English

transcription, транскрипция: [ beɪl ]

( bales, baling, baled)

1.

A bale is a large quantity of something such as hay, cloth, or paper, tied together tightly.

...bales of hay.

N-COUNT : usu pl , usu with supp

2.

If something such as hay, cloth, or paper is baled , it is tied together tightly.

Once hay has been cut and baled it has to go through some chemical processes.

VERB : be V-ed , also V n
